Ingredients
Scale
- 1 small head cabbage (cut into thick slices)
- 2 tablespoons olive oil (for brushing)
- 1 pound ground beef or turkey (or plant-based alternatives)
- 1 medium onion (finely chopped)
- 2 cloves garlic (minced)
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
- 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
- 1 large egg (optional)
- 1 cup shredded cheese
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F.
- Cut the cabbage into thick slices, about an inch wide.
- Brush both sides of the cabbage slices with olive oil.
- In a mixing bowl, combine the ground meat, onion, garlic, salt, pepper, smoked paprika, Worcestershire sauce, and egg if using; mix well.
- Shape the mixture into patties matching the width of the cabbage slices.
- Arrange cabbage slices on a baking sheet and top each with a patty.
- Sprinkle cheese over each patty.
- Bake in the preheated oven for about 25 minutes until cooked through and tender.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 25 minutes
